Pizza Calzone with Beef Ingredients

Satisfy your cravings with these essential ingredients for your perfectly crafted calzone!

For the Filling

  • Ground Beef – Provides savory protein and richness; substitute with ground turkey or chicken for a lighter option.
  • Mozzarella Cheese – Melts beautifully, contributing creaminess; use provolone or cheddar for a different flavor profile.
  • Pizza Sauce – Adds moisture and flavor; make homemade with crushed tomatoes, garlic, and Italian spices for a fresh take.
  • Pepperoni (optional) – Adds spice and flavor; omit for a beef-only option or replace with veggies for a vegetarian version.

For the Dough

  • Pizza Dough – The base for the calzone; store-bought for convenience, or homemade for authenticity.

For the Glaze

  • Egg (for brushing) – Creates a golden-brown crust; use milk or olive oil as an alternative.

How to Make Pizza Calzone with Beef

  1. Cook the Beef: Heat a skillet over medium heat and add ground beef. Season with salt, pepper, and Italian seasoning. Cook until browned, then stir in minced garlic for an additional minute to enhance the flavor.

  2. Prepare Dough: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C). On a floured surface, roll out pizza dough into a 12-inch circle, ensuring it’s evenly thin for a crispy crust.

  3. Fill the Calzone: Spread a generous layer of pizza sauce on one half of the dough. Add the cooked beef mixture, followed by mozzarella cheese and pepperoni, if desired. Fold the other half over and crimp the edges well to seal.

  4. Bake: Carefully place the filled calzone on a parchment-lined baking sheet. Brush the top with a beaten egg for a lovely golden color. Bake for 20-25 minutes or until the crust is golden brown and crispy.

  5. Cool and Serve: Once baked, allow the calzone to cool for a few minutes. This resting time helps the cheese set for easier slicing. Serve warm with extra pizza sauce on the side for dipping.

Optional: Garnish with fresh herbs like basil or oregano for an extra burst of flavor.

Make Ahead Options

These Pizza Calzones with Beef are perfect for meal prep enthusiasts! You can cook the ground beef mixture and prepare the pizza dough up to 24 hours in advance. Simply refrigerate the cooked beef in an airtight container and roll out the dough, sealing it tightly to keep it fresh. For added convenience, you can also fill the calzones and keep them in the fridge, ready to bake but remember to cover them with plastic wrap to prevent drying out. When you’re ready to serve, brush with egg and pop them in a preheated oven—baking for about 20-25 minutes until golden brown. Storage Tips for Pizza Calzone with Beef

  • Room Temperature: Allow the calzone to cool completely before storing. You can leave it out at room temperature for up to 2 hours before refrigeration.
  •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. This helps retain moisture and prevent the crust from becoming soggy.
  • Freezer: For longer storage, wrap the calzone t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il, and freeze for up to 2 months. Thaw in the fridge overnight before reheating.
  • Reheating: To reheat, place the calzone in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for 15-20 minutes, or until heated through. This keeps the crust crispy, making your Pizza Calzone with Beef just as delightful as the first bite!

Expert Tips for Pizza Calzone with Beef

  • Avoid Overfilling: Too much filling can cause the calzone to burst during baking. Stick to a moderate amount for the perfect bite!
  • Seal It Well: Ensure you crimp the edges securely to prevent leakage. A well-sealed calzone leads to a mess-free experience.
  • Let It Rest: Allow the calzone to cool for a few minutes after baking; this helps the cheese set for easier slicing and serving.
  • Check Dough Thickness: Roll the pizza dough evenly to ensure a crispy, golden crust. Thicker dough may result in sogginess.
